SpletSweat lodge : Probably the most recognised of all Native American ceremonies, although this tradition has existed in various forms in many ethnic cultures. A sweat lodge is constructed with bent wooden poles covered with canvas or blankets. In the centre is a pit into which is placed hot rocks previously heated in a fire outside of the lodge.
